Remember the stupid “vanishing G-spot” story everybody got all excited about two weeks ago? Well, I am reliably informed that when the cutting-edge social commentators on The View got their fingers firmly on the story, Barbara Walters opined as follows:

“Women should be happy about the study that says it doesn’t exist — it’s one less thing to worry about.”